Output fdbbf682be813820231f90eb71c4b6c38ecaacd955e0a3b430f2d38ccaa799e3:6

value
25730000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e07cfecc2e8fe53de12c889cb2feec4d8beac899 OP_EQUALVERIFY OP_CHECKSIG
address
1MTz6oAVo2BcnHp3BrkqxKHqnkV7cfD9Yb
transaction
fdbbf682be813820231f90eb71c4b6c38ecaacd955e0a3b430f2d38ccaa799e3
spent
true